I applied online. The process took 2 months. I interviewed at Advantage Solutions (Apollo Beach, FL) in May 2017
Interview
Completed all the initial online application process resulting in a phone screening. I was emailed interview questions from the supplier Advantage Solutions was representing as well as Advantage questions I should be prepared for during my online skype interview. I did lots of reading and research on both companies to prepare and have a solid interview. Proceeded to have the interview that went well. This is when things broke down. Communication stopped so I contacted the company to follow up. At this point I was told the territory position I applied to was being rearranged and it could take some time. At this point I asked if the application I submitted will still be good or will I have to reapply and go through the process again. I was told I would have no need that my application will simply slide over to whatever position is created or available but it will take some time and they couldn't give me a time frame. I started noticing a few weeks later positions being posted and emailed back if I was still being considered. At this point I was told that the position I applied for was abolished but I could reapply to others. I specifically asked weeks prior to this if I needed to reapply and was told "no need" but now I'm told another story. It was pretty disappointing because this seemed like a strong company that I was highly interested in but this process and communication was very poor, sloppy, and frankly a bit dishonest.
